does anyone know how to solve this? ​ I have to find lengths FJ, DM, and EM

Answers

Answer:

FJ= 24

DM= 16

EM= 18

Step-by-step explanation:

The centroid is twice as close along any median to the side that the median intersects as it is to the vertex it emanates from.

So in the case of FJ, the median intersects the side at point J and extends from vertex F. This means that FM is twice as long as MJ. It tells us that MJ is 8, so MF would be 16. Now because FJ is just FM+MJ, FJ is 24.

It also tells us that DK is 24, which means that DM+MK = 24. If DM is twice as long as MK, that would make MK equal to 8 and DM equal to 16

Similarily, EM would be twice as long as ML. It says that ML=9 so that would make EM=18

Lauren wants to gift wrap a box which is in the shape of a cube. The dimensions of the cube is 25 cm. Determine the surface area of the box to knov
how much wrapping paper should be purchased.

Answers

Answer:

3,750cm²

Step-by-step explanation:

Total surface area of a cube is expressed as;

A = 6L²

L is the side length of the cube;

Given

L = 25cm

TSA = 6 (25)²

TSA = 6 * 625

TSA = 3,750cm²

Hence the total surface area of the box is 3,750cm²
